Art Department

     
The Art department is in the purpose built 'technology block' and consists of two main teaching rooms and a smaller studio, used mainly by sixth form students to develop coursework during their non-contact time. There is a large electric kiln and a well-equipped photographic darkroom.

All students take art in years 7 to 9, after which it becomes an optional examination subject. Art is a popular choice for GCSE, A/S and A level. Each year there is an exhibition of students art work, to see some their work use the links below.

The department produces an annual ‘publication’ to celebrate the work of the students.  In previous years this has taken the form of a calendar illustrated with examples of student art work, most recently a diary was produced which proved to be very popular.
